Clear as Ever - Chapter 4

  1. Home
  2. Clear as Ever
  3. Chapter 4
Prev
Next

Junior Shishu did not break my legs.

The noble and aloof Lord Frostmoon neither lectured me nor agreed to my absurd request. When I insisted that Lanshu and I were truly in love, he merely slid a sound-recording stone across the table.

It contained Feng Lanshu’s voice accepting a wager with several other disciples.

“Junior Brother Feng, if your charm really is unmatched, what’s the point of flirting only with inner disciples? You just arrived, so you may not know that our sect has one very special senior sister.”

“She grew up on Bright Moon Cliff. She’s—pfft—a true fairy, dwelling high above the mortal world.”

Feng Lanshu sounded indifferent. “A fairy? No fairy could be more beautiful than my mother. I’m not interested in this Senior Sister Xie.”

The disciple kept provoking him. “Are you uninterested, or not confident you can win her? Senior Sister Xie is engaged to Kunlun’s foremost disciple and was raised beside the world-renowned Lord Frostmoon. Her standards aren’t ordinary.”

“If you can seduce her into ending that engagement for you, then we’ll believe your charm is truly unrivaled.”

Amid the cheering, Feng Lanshu accepted the wager to prove he was irresistible.

Our instant connection had been a lie.

His injury from saving me had been staged.

Every tender word was merely a sacrifice made to win a bet.

I was furious enough to curse, yet could not force a single obscenity from my mouth. After leaving Bright Moon Cliff with as much composure as I could muster, I burst into tears.

With my fiancé, I had imagined feelings that were never there. With Junior Shishu, I had failed to understand my place.

But Feng Lanshu had approached me.

He alone had said he liked me. He alone had called me special and made me believe that, for once, I was loved.

Yet the ending was exactly the same.

Covering my face, I sobbed until I could hardly breathe.

“So there truly isn’t anyone in this world who could love me.”

A person could not even sympathize with herself from four days ago.

Four days ago, I had wept because Feng Lanshu did not love me. After dual cultivating with him for a day and a night, I suddenly couldn’t care less.

I climbed out of bed and examined myself in a mirror. My face seemed more refined, as though a pearl were gradually being washed clean. My dull eyes had become clear and bright, my skin smooth and flushed. I looked as if I had swallowed a legendary marrow-cleansing pill.

While I admired my radiant reflection, Feng Lanshu lay sprawled across my bed, half asleep and without a patch of unmarked skin. His empty arms suddenly tightened.

Finding nothing there, he woke with a start and searched frantically until he saw me at the mirror. Only then did embarrassment catch up with him. He dragged the blanket over his naked body.

“Xie Qingru…” Staring down at the soiled bedding, he asked, “Don’t you have anything to say to me?”

I was in a good mood, so I praised him. “You performed well. You thoroughly proved your ability.”

His brow furrowed. “That isn’t what I meant. What are we now?”

I smiled at my reflection. “Senior sister and junior brother, of course.”

He stared at me as if he had misheard. “That isn’t what you said last night. Didn’t you promise to take responsibility if I let you sleep with me?”

“A phoenix can have only one lover in a lifetime. What am I supposed to do if you refuse?”

At last satisfied with my reflection, I put down the mirror and looked him over.

“Why should I care? You heartless, rotten bird. How dare you demand responsibility from me?”

“You wagered on my engagement. It’s only fair that I take revenge.”

The blood drained from his face, leaving only a red haze in his eyes. He was already devastatingly beautiful; looking fragile and broken made him even more pitiful.

His scabbed lips moved as though he were desperately explaining something. I ignored every word. All I could think was that his mouth looked very kissable.

Hmm.

I reached a decision.

“Feng Lanshu, come to me once every three days from now on, until I grow tired of sleeping with you.”

He looked like a puppet whose strings had been cut. After a long while, his eyes finally moved toward me.

“Impossible,” he rasped. “Don’t even dream of it, Xie Qingru.”

I spread my hands. “Or would you rather everyone learn that you failed to make me end my engagement, lost your own chastity in the bargain, and came away with nothing?”

He stared at me through tears as though I were the most heartless creature alive.

I remained unmoved. “Cheer up. I enjoy dual cultivating with you. Doesn’t that prove your charm?”

Feng Lanshu did not cheer up.

He gathered his clothes from the floor. Tears blurred his vision, and he fumbled every tie until his robes hung in complete disarray.

He left without looking back.

He had not agreed to my demand.

But he had not refused it either.

I gave a cheerful whistle.

Sooner or later, he would agree.
